30101019 Lymphoproliferative disorder with pathological fracture of the femur in a patient with rhe 2018 Aug Methotrexate (MTX) is the key drug for the treatment of rheumatoid arthritis (RA). MTX-treated RA has been associated with the development of lymphoproliferative disorders (LPDs). Notably, the hyperimmune state of RA itself or the immunosuppressive state induced by MTX administration may contribute to development of LPD. Furthermore, Epstein-Barr virus (EBV) has been indicated to contribute to the development of MTX-LPD. MTX-associated LPD (MTX-LPD) may affect nodal or extranodal sites, including the gastrointestinal tract, skin, lungs, kidneys, and soft tissues, at an almost equal frequency. However, it is rare for MTX-LPD to manifest as multiple bone tumors with a pathological fracture. The present study reported the case of a 46-year-old Japanese woman with RA who had complications of EBV-positive MTX-LPD during an approximate 5-year course of MTX therapy. The present study indicated a rare case in which the LPD had spread to multiple bones in a patient with a pathologic fracture. Notably, the LPD was subclassified as diffuse large B-cell lymphoma (DLBCL).
30607397 Inflammation beyond the Joints: Rheumatoid Arthritis and Cardiovascular Disease. 2018 Rheumatoid Arthritis (RA), a chronic systemic inflammatory disease which affects approximately 1% of the population, is classically characterized by inflammation and synovitis that leads to cartilage damage and juxta-articular bone destruction. Accumulating evidence indicates that a major cause of death among RA patients is Cardio Vascular Disease (CVD), in excess of that in the general population. In this review, we discuss the epidemiology of CVD in RA populations, the underlying pathophysiologic mechanisms of CVD in RA including the role of chronic inflammation in driving accelerated atherosclerosis, the obesity paradox and altered metabolic pathways leading to pro-inflammatory HDL formation and insulin resistance. We also discuss the pitfalls in the evaluation of CVD utilizing traditional risk scores which tend to underestimate CVD risk in RA population and the efforts directed to find more accurate predictors for early CVD detection. Finally, we will present the latest developments in the evaluation and management of CVD in RA patients, given recent evidence on the role of inflammation and its impact on CVD.
30588174 Serum adiponectin as a predictor of laboratory response to anti-TNF-α therapy in rheumato 2018 INTRODUCTION: While adiponectin is typically viewed as an anti-inflammatory mediator, such an activity of adiponectin in rheumatoid arthritis (RA) is not so obvious. In the present study we examined whether serum levels of adiponectin reflect the clinical phenotype of RA patients and/or correlate with severity of the disease and the response to anti-TNF-α therapy. MATERIAL AND METHODS: Twenty-one female RA patients qualified to receive anti-TNF-α treatment were prospectively assessed before and after 12 weeks of therapy. Patients underwent full clinical and biochemical assessment. Disease activity was assessed by the Modified Disease Activity Scores (DAS28). Serum concentrations of adiponectin were measured with an immunoassay. The individuals were divided into two subgroups according to whether their baseline serum adiponectin was below or above the median value. The subgroups did not differ in basic demographic, anthropometric, and clinical parameters. RESULTS: Anti-TNF-α treatment resulted in a significant clinical (DAS28) improvement in patients from both subgroups, but no significant differences between basal and post-treatment serum adiponectin concentrations were observed. However, patients with higher baseline adiponectin experienced a significant and more pronounced improvement in laboratory parameters of inflammation (ESR, CRP, neutrophil count, neutrophil-to-lymphocyte ratio). CONCLUSIONS: It is possible that adiponectin exerts systemic anti-inflammatory effects independently of the local activity of RA.
30568425 Infliximab dose adjustment can improve the clinical and radiographic outcomes of rheumatoi 2018 PURPOSE: We evaluated the clinical responses and radiographic outcomes of 90 patients with rheumatoid arthritis (RA) undergoing continuous or dose-adjusted infliximab treatment over 104 weeks. PATIENTS AND METHODS: Patients received 3 mg/kg infliximab continuously (the contin group; n=50), or the dose escalation and de-escalation of infliximab (3, 6, and 10 mg/kg) from week 14 (the adjusted group; n=40) based on the patient's Disease Activity Score in 28 joints (DAS28). The retention rate, clinical response, and radiographic assessment were determined at week 104. RESULTS: The contin and adjusted groups' retention rates at week 104 were 56.8 and 66.7%, and the groups' low disease activity in the DAS28 was 39.1 and 66.7%, respectively. Remission based on the DAS28 and the American College of Rheumatology (ACR)/European League against Rheumatism (EULAR) Boolean-based criteria was significantly increased in the adjusted group. In the radiographic assessment, there was also a significant reduction in the mean changes in total Sharp score. The cumulative rates of any adverse effects showed no significant difference between the groups. CONCLUSION: In an assessment of adequate DAS28 results, the RA patients who did not respond to the initial dose of infliximab showed improved clinical responses and radiographic assessment after a dose adjustment of infliximab, without an increased risk of serious adverse events.
29506437 Adult-onset Still's disease with prominent polyserositis. 2018 May Adult-onset Still's disease is a systemic autoinflammatory disease the presentation of which can often mimic infection. As a consequence, there is often a delay in diagnosis. Serositis is a recognised but less common clinical feature that can result in complications including cardiac tamponade and constrictive pericarditis. We describe a case of adult-onset Still's disease without the hallmark rash or significant arthritis, presenting with polyserositis that showed a good response to initial steroid treatment and sustained remission with anakinra. An elevated procalcitonin level was due to active adult-onset Still's disease, not bacterial infection.
29779214 Cyanidin-3-glucoside inhibits inflammatory activities in human fibroblast-like synoviocyte 2018 Oct Rheumatoid arthritis (RA) is a chronic autoimmune disease characterized by joint tissue inflammation. Cyanidin-3-glucoside (C3G) is a major component in the flavonoid family and has shown anti-inflammatory, anti-oxidant and anti-tumour activity. In this study, we investigated the effects of C3G on lipopolysaccharides (LPS)-induced inflammation on human rheumatoid fibroblast-like synoviocytes (FLS) and on collagen-induced arthritis (CIA) mice model. We treated FLS with C3G followed by LPS induction, the expressions of tumour necrosis factor alpha (TNF-α), interleukin 1 beta (IL-1β) and IL-6 and the activation of nuclear factor kappa-light-chain-enhancer of activated B cells (NF-κB) and mitogen-activated protein kinase (MAPK) signalling pathway were analyzed. CIA was induced in mice and the arthritic mice were treated with C3G for 3 weeks. The disease severity was compared between control and C3G treated mice. The serum levels of TNF-α, IL-1β and IL-6 were analyzed by ELISA. C3G inhibited LPS-induced TNF-α, IL-1β and IL-6 expression in FLS. Moreover, C3G inhibited LPS-induced p65 production and IκBa, p38, ERK and JNK phosphorylation. Administration of C3G significantly attenuated disease in mice with CIA and decreased the serum level of TNF-α, IL-1β and IL-6. C3G inhibited LPS-induced inflammation in human FLS by inhibiting activation of NF-κB and MAPK signalling pathway. C3G exhibited therapeutic effects in mice with CIA.
29900970 The Association of Anti-Aminoacyl-Transfer Ribonucleic Acid Synthetase Antibodies in Patie 2018 Mar OBJECTIVES: This study aims to analyze the distribution and clinicopathological characteristics of anti-aminoacyl-transfer ribonucleic acid (tRNA) synthetase (ARS) antibodies in rheumatoid arthritis patients. PATIENTS AND METHODS: We retrospectively studied the anti-ARS antibody levels in 228 RA patients' (44 males, 184 females; mean age 62.9±14.0 years; range 23 to 88 years) sera from their medical charts. We determined the association with anti-cyclic citrullinated peptide antibody levels, interstitial lung disease (ILD), rheumatoid factor, and methotrexate or biological disease modifying antirheumatic drug treatments. RESULTS: Anti-ARS antibodies were detected in 14 RA patients (6.1%). ILD complications were significantly higher among anti-ARS antibody-positive patients (57.1% vs 22.4%, p<0.05). Levels of anti-threonyl-tRNA-synthetase (anti-PL-7) and anti-alanyl-tRNA-synthetase (anti-PL-12), two anti-ARS antibodies, were higher in RA patients with concurrent ILD (both p<0.05). Myositis and ILD worsening were not observed in three anti-ARS antibody- positive patients despite biological disease modifying antirheumatic drug administration. There was no difference in anti-cyclic citrullinated peptide and rheumatoid factor specificities between patients with or without ARS antibodies. CONCLUSION: Anti-ARS antibodies were detected in RA patients, with higher prevalence in patients with concurrent ILD. RA patients, specifically those with ILD complications, should be tested for anti-ARS antibodies.
29027192 Hip resurfacing arthroplasty for patients with inflammatory arthritis: a systematic review 2018 Jan INTRODUCTION: Modern metal-on-metal hip resurfacing arthroplasty has led to decreased revision rates and high implant survival rates as compared to prior generations of resurfacing. Many of the series that report on resurfacing outcomes focus upon patients treated with a diagnosis of osteoarthritis. Patients with inflammatory arthritis such as rheumatoid arthritis (RA) and ankylosing spondylitis (AS) are also treated in these series, however, their outcomes following resurfacing are underreported. The aim of this study was to determine complications that may occur following hip resurfacing in patients with inflammatory arthritis. A secondary aim was to determine functional outcomes following resurfacing. METHODS: A search was performed in MEDLINE (PubMed/OVID), Cochrane Library, and Google Scholar. 5 studies met eligibility criteria. This review includes 196 hips; 120 had a diagnosis of AS or seronegative spondyloarthropathy and 76 had a diagnosis of RA or juvenile RA. 8 revisions were reported at a mean time of 64.2 (8.67-275.58) weeks. RESULTS: Femoral neck fracture was the most common indication for revision, occurring in 3.06% of all hips at 34.5 weeks (16.0-52.0). 2 infections, 2 reports of acetabular radiolucency, and no dislocations were reported. The University of California at Los Angeles score, Harris Hip Score, and Range of Motion were the most common functional outcomes measured, which increased in the majority of studies following resurfacing. CONCLUSIONS: Femoral neck fracture was the most common reason for revision in patients with inflammatory arthritis following resurfacing and there were no dislocations reported. Following resurfacing, these patients have improved functional outcomes.
29599624 Histological Evaluation of Lumbar Spine Changes in Rats with Collagen-induced Arthritis. 2018 Mar BACKGROUND: To histologically evaluate lumbar involvement in rheumatoid arthritis (RA) by investigating rats with collagen-induced arthritis (CIA) and to assess the potential effects of RA on the discovertebral joints and facet joints. METHODS: Seven-month-old female Sprague-Dawley rats were divided into groups with CIA and without CIA (control). All rats were sacrificed at 8 weeks after initial sensitization and the lumbar spine (L5/6) was harvested. Then the lumbar spine block specimens were stained with Villaneuva bone stain and sectioned in the midsagittal plane. The left facet joints were also sectioned in the midaxial plane. Specimens were studied under a microscope and infiltration of inflammatory cells was investigated. RESULTS: In the CIA group, lumbar lesions were observed in 13/18 rats (76%). Lymphocytes infiltrated into the anterior rim of the vertebral bodies only in 2 rats, while lymphocytes infiltrated the facet joints only in 4 rats. Both sites were involved in 7 rats. In addition, osteoclasts invaded the anterior rim of the vertebral bodies and formed cavities that also contained lymphocytes. Formation of pannus was seen in the facet joints in 11/18 rats. CONCLUSION: In CIA rats, infiltration of inflammatory cells into the anterior rim of the vertebral bodies alone or into the facet joints alone was demonstrated in 2 rats and 4 rats, respectively, while both sites were involved in 7 rats. Therefore, lesions at the anterior rim of the vertebral body did not arise secondary to facet joint involvement, but were caused by CIA along with synovial lesions of the facet joints.
30013786 Use of autologous bone grafting from the calcaneus and interconnected porous hydroxyapatit 2018 Cancellous bone grafts from the calcaneus have been used for the foot and ankle as well as iliac bone graft; however, there is a sparse report for calcaneal bone transplantation in the field of rheumatoid foot surgery. In this study, safety and usefulness of calcaneal bone grafts, and combination with interconnected porous hydroxyapatite ceramic, was evaluated in rheumatoid arthritis foot surgeries. Of six rheumatoid arthritis cases, three (talo-navicular joint fusion) used a calcaneal bone graft alone, and the remaining three cases (subtalar joint and talo-navicular joint fusion) used a combination of calcaneal bone graft and interconnected porous hydroxyapatite ceramic augmented with dense calcium hydroxyapatite for subtalar bony defect (1.5-2.0 cm) after the correction. Pre- and postoperative Japanese Society for Surgery of the Foot rheumatoid arthritis foot ankle scale scores were obtained for the clinical assessment. As radiographic assessment, tibio-calcaneal angle, calcaneal pitch, talo-1st metatarsal angle, and pronated foot index were also evaluated. After starting weight-bearing or walking, there was no pain and skin trouble at the fusion and harvesting sites. All cases achieved bony fusion within 6-10 weeks. Japanese Society for Surgery of the Foot rheumatoid arthritis foot ankle score was improved in all six cases. Furthermore, tibio-calcaneal angle, talo-1st metatarsal angle, and pronated foot index were also improved at latest follow-up in all cases. In conclusion, autologous bone grafting from the calcaneus was safe and convenient even in rheumatoid foot surgeries. For larger bony defects (1.5-2.0 cm), combination use with interconnected porous hydroxyapatite ceramic augmented with dense calcium hydroxyapatite was also useful.
30143001 Suspected drug-induced liver injury associated with iguratimod: a case report and review o 2018 Aug 24 BACKGROUND: Iguratimod is a novel anti-rheumatic drug with the capability of anti-cytokines as report goes. It has been reported that iguratimod is effective and safe for rheumatoid arthritis and other rheumatisms. As side effects, iguratimod can cause gastrointestinal reactions, dizziness, headache and itchy. CASE PRESENTATION: In this case report, a 60-year-old female patient was admitted with suspected drug-induced liver injury (DILI) caused by iguratimod. The causality assessment was done by the updated RUCAM, and the possibility of the case in our paper diagnosed as highly probable for the score was 9 points. Iguratimod was discontinued immediately, and methylprednisolone was used for acute liver injury and Sjogren's syndrome. The data showed the patient has improved gradually, and she was discharged on day 27. The true incidence of iguratimod-related hepatotoxicity and its pathogenic mechanism are largely unknown. It is difficult to recognize and diagnose DILI, and there is no standard for diagnosis of DILI. At the same time, the DILI is still lack of specific treatment. CONCLUSIONS: Based on this rare case of severe liver injury, we recommend careful monitoring of liver function throughout iguratimod treatment for diseases.
29887906 Ultrasonographic findings of rheumatoid arthritis patients who are in clinical remission. 2018 BACKGROUND: The aim of this study was to recognize the findings of ultrasonography (US) in remitted rheumatic arthritis (RA) patients for detection subclinical arthritis. MATERIALS AND METHODS: This descriptive study was conducted during 2016 in a rheumatology center. A total of 70 patients with remitted RA were included in the study. Sonography was performed on all 70 patients who did not show any clinical arthritis in clinical examination to find synovitis and effusion were evaluated with gray scale and hyperemia with power Doppler US. RESULTS: Nearly 44.3% (n = 31) of our patients had positive sonography results including 20% synovitis, 21.4% hyperemia, and 18.6% (n = 13) effusion. A total of 1960 joints of 70 patients were evaluated, in which 3.2% (n = 63) of joints had positive sonography findings including 1.2% synovitis, 1.5% hyperemia, and 1.1 with effusion. CONCLUSION: US can diagnosis subclinical arthritis in patients with remitted RA who does not show any joint involvement in clinical examination.
30588173 Correlation of interleukin 6 and transforming growth factor β1 with peripheral blood regu 2018 INTRODUCTION: Proinflammatory cytokines and regulatory T cells (Tregs) are considered as important factors involved in autoimmunity development especially in rheumatoid arthritis (RA). AIM OF THE STUDY: To investigate the frequency of peripheral blood Tregs and related cytokines in RA patients and to determine the possible correlation between Treg percentage and interleukin 6 (IL-6) and transforming growth factor β1 (TGF-β1) as indicators in assessment of Treg function and mechanisms preceding autoimmunity in RA. MATERIAL AND METHODS: Thirty-seven Iranian RA patients with a moderate (3.2-5.1) disease activity score (DAS) and the same number of healthy age- and sex-matched individuals were enrolled. Frequency of peripheral blood Tregs (CD4(+)FoxP3(+)CD25(high)) was determined by flow cytometry. Serum levels of IL-6 and TGF-β1 and their expression levels in peripheral blood mononuclear cells (PBMCs) were evaluated by ELISA and Q-PCR, respectively. RESULTS: Rheumatoid arthritis patients showed significantly lower peripheral blood Treg frequencies compared to healthy individuals. Additionally, Treg (%) showed a significant inverse correlation between serum concentrations of IL-6 and mRNA expression of PBMCs, whereas there was no significant correlation between Treg (%) and TGF-β1 levels. CONCLUSIONS: The current study revealed that Treg numbers were reduced in peripheral blood of RA patients. This reduction inversely correlated with IL-6 levels, which may lead to persistent autoimmune and inflammatory conditions in RA patients.
28781105 Adult onset Still's disease occurring during pregnancy: Case-report and literature review. 2018 Feb INTRODUCTION: Adult onset Still's disease is a rare affection classified among non-hereditary autoinflammatory diseases. We here report a case of AOSD revealed during pregnancy with a life-threatening presentation along with a review of 19 cases from literature. CASE: A 38-years old woman was treated in our department for diffuse systemic sclerosis and associated Sjögren syndrome. She was pregnant and presented with acute fever and arthralgias. Laboratory data revealed mild liver cytolysis but a large screening for infectious and auto-immune diseases was negative and hepato-biliar imaging was normal. Ferritin levels were at 41 000 ng/mL with glycosylated ferritin less than 5%. The diagnosis of AOSD was stated and because of persistent fever and polyarthralgias, after exclusion of active infection, steroids were started (prednisone 1 mg/kg) associated with colchicine, which allowed clinical remission and C-reactive protein significant decrease. CONCLUSION: Pregnancy-revealed AOSD appears to be a specifical subset of the disease with a systemic course, flares on first and second trimester, obstetrical complications such as prematurity and IUGR sometimes leading to life-threatening situations requiring parenteral corticotherapy and intravenous immunoglobulins.
30508859 [Sjögren's Syndrome: Early diagnosis and effective treatment]. 2018 Dec Primary Sjögren's syndrome (pSS) is an autoimmune disease affecting the salivary and lachrymal glands. The patients complain of symptoms of dry eyes and dry mouth, but up to 50 % may additionally develop extraglandular manifestations such as arthritis, vasculitis, polyneuropathy, pulmonary fibrosis or interstitial nephritis. Most therapeutic studies on the glandular manifestations of pSS failed to meet their primary endpoints, possibly since many of the patients had already advanced and irreversible disease.In recent years several important advances have been made. The role of B and T lymphocytes in the pathogenesis of pSS has been identified. The disease activity scores ESSDAI and ESSPRI were developed and can now be used as endpoints in therapeutical studies. Since then, numerous promising new drugs, mostly affecting B and T lymphocytes, have been studied in clinical trials. New classification criteria have been proposed, which will be an important tool in making a diagnosis in an early disease stage, in which the glandular function may still be normal. It is very likely therefore, that we will soon have efficient therapies, which will be able to stop the disease progression in an early stage of pSS.
30469466 Defective T-Cell Apoptosis and T-Regulatory Cell Dysfunction in Rheumatoid Arthritis. 2018 Nov 22 Rheumatoid arthritis (RA) is a chronic, progressive, systemic autoimmune disease that mostly affects small and large synovial joints. At the molecular level, RA is characterized by a profoundly defective innate and adaptive immune response that results in a chronic state of inflammation. Two of the most significant alterations in T-lymphocyte (T-cell) dysfunction in RA is the perpetual activation of T-cells that result in an abnormal proliferation state which also stimulate the proliferation of fibroblasts within the joint synovial tissue. This event results in what we have termed "apoptosis resistance", which we believe is the leading cause of aberrant cell survival in RA. Finding therapies that will induce apoptosis under these conditions is one of the current goals of drug discovery. Over the past several years, a number of T-cell subsets have been identified. One of these T-cell subsets are the T-regulatory (T(reg)) cells. Under normal conditions T(reg) cells dictate the state of immune tolerance. However, in RA, the function of T(reg) cells become compromised resulting in T(reg) cell dysfunction. It has now been shown that several of the drugs employed in the medical therapy of RA can partially restore T(reg) cell function, which has also been associated with amelioration of the clinical symptoms of RA.
30487995 ACPA and RF as predictors of sustained clinical remission in patients with rheumatoid arth 2018 OBJECTIVES: This study evaluated the interaction of anticitrullinated protein antibody (ACPA) and rheumatoid factor (RF) in predicting sustained clinical response in an observational registry of patients with rheumatoid arthritis (RA) followed in routine practice. METHODS: Patients with RA enrolled in the Ontario Best Practices Research Initiative registry, with ≥1 swollen joint, autoantibody information and ≥1 follow-up assessment were included. Sustained clinical remission was defined as Clinical Disease Activity Index (CDAI) ≤2.8 in at least two sequential visits separated by 3-12 months. Time to sustained remission was assessed using cumulative incidence curves and multivariate cox regression. RESULTS: Among 3251 patients in the registry, 970 were included, of whom 262 (27%) were ACPA(neg)/RF(neg), 60 (6.2%) ACPA(pos) /RF(neg), 117 (12.1%) ACPA(neg)/RF(pos) and 531 (54.7%) ACPA(pos) /RF(pos) at baseline. Significant between group differences were observed in age (p=0.02), CDAI (p=0.03), tender joint count (p=0.02) and Health Assessment Questionnaire (p=0.002), with ACPA(pos) patients being youngest with lowest disease activity and disability. No difference in biologic use was found between groups (20.2% of patients).Over a mean follow-up of 3 years, sustained remission was achieved by 43.5% of ACPA(pos)/RF(pos) patients, 43.3% of ACPA(pos) /RF(neg) patients, 31.6 % of ACPA(neg)/RF(pos) patients and 32.4% of ACPA(neg)/RF(neg) patients (p=0.01). Significant differences were observed in CDAI improvement based on ACPA and RF status where ACPA(pos)/RF(pos) had a shorter time to achieving sustained remission (HR 1.30; 95% CI 1.01 to 1.67) and experienced significantly higher improvements compared with ACPA(neg)/RF(neg) patients. CONCLUSIONS: Combined ACPA and RF positivity were associated with improved and faster response to antirheumatic medications in patients with RA.
30244449 Human Xenograft Model. 2018 Human-SCID grafting is a commonly used technique for the long-term investigation of rheumatoid arthritis (RA) explants. To establish a chimeric immunological system in NOD/SCID mice, RA patient-derived pannus tissue from the synovial membrane, articular cartilage, and bone can be transplanted subcutaneously. The same patient-derived peripheral blood mononuclear cell chimerism can be successfully achieved by intraperitoneal engraftment. This xenograft model is able to be used for initial screening of human target-specified biologics.
29398958 Treatment Response Evaluation using Yttrium-90 in Patients with Rheumatoid Arthritis of Kn 2018 Jan For radiosynovectomy, we have measured the retention time of yttrium-90 ((90)Y) hydroxyapatite (particle size 1-10 μm) within the knee joint space and evaluated the treatment responses in knees with rheumatoid arthritis. Radioactive measurements in the region of knee after injection of (90)Y hydroxyapatite into the joint space were made with a single prove system designed to monitor radioactivity and showed retention of (90)Y in the knee ranged 76.6% ±5.4% after 4 days of injection. The clinical improvements in rheumatoid arthritis of knee joint with steinbroker Stages I and II were increased as time goes by, the improvement ratio is in 72% at 6(th) months and 76% at 12(th) months after injection of (90)Y 185 MBq (5 mCi) per joint.
28975544 The role of α9β1 integrin and its ligands in the development of autoimmune diseases. 2018 Mar Adhesion of cells to extracellular matrix proteins through integrins expressed on the cell surface is important for cell adhesion/motility, survival, and differentiation. Recently, α9β1 integrin was reported to be important for the development of autoimmune diseases including rheumatoid arthritis, multiple sclerosis, and their murine models. In addition, ligands for α9β1 integrin, such as osteopontin and tenascin-C, are well established as key regulators of autoimmune diseases. Therefore, this review focused on the role of interactions between α9β1 integrin and its ligands in the development of autoimmune diseases.
